Vilnius
[ vil-nee-oos ]
noun
a city in and the capital of Lithuania, in the SE part: formerly in the Soviet Union and earlier in Poland.
- Polish Wilno.
- Russian Vil·na [vyeel-nuh; English vil-nuh]. /ˈvyil nə; English ˈvɪl nə/.

British Dictionary definitions for Vilnius
Vilnius
Vilnyus
/ (ˈvɪlnɪʊs) /
noun
the capital of Lithuania: passed to Russia in 1795; under Polish rule (1920–39); university (1578); an industrial and commercial centre. Pop: 544 000 (2005 est): Russian name: Vilna (ˈvilna) Polish name: Wilno
